Texoma Medical Center, a 414-bed acute care facility has been providing quality health care to the residents of North Texas and Southern Oklahoma since 1965. Our main campus is located in Denison, Texas, approximately one hour north of the Dallas/Fort Worth area and just south of the Texas/Oklahoma border. In addition, we have numerous facilities in locations throughout the Texoma region. Since 1965, TMC has forged a special relationship with the people of North Texas and Southern Oklahoma. Texoma residents have come to depend on TMC to meet a spectrum of physical, mental and spiritual needs. TMC has responded with unique services to provide the kind of sophisticated, experienced care that was once was available only in major metropolitan areas. We offer major specialty services including open heart surgery and neurosurgery. Advanced resources such as certified trauma care support TMC's role as a regional specialty center.
Headquartered in King of Prussia, PA, Universal Health Services, Inc. (NYSE: UHS) is one of the nation’s largest and most respected providers of hospital and healthcare services. Since our founding in 1979, UHS has grown steadily into a premier Fortune 500® corporation perennially recognized by multiple esteemed national rating entities. Through its subsidiaries, UHS operates inpatient acute care facilities, inpatient behavioral health facilities, outpatient and other facilities, nationwide virtual behavioral health services, an insurance offering, a physician network and various related services with physical locations in the U.S., Puerto Rico, Ireland and United Kingdom.www.uhs.com.

This position is responsible for supervision of the Center Scheduling department to include insurance eligibility, authorizations, scheduling and pre-registration. Performing managerial functions including staff leadership, decision making, setting department standards and policy guidelines.
Minimum two years of college education or equivalent related work experience.
Two years experience in billing, collections and/or reimbursement experience in a healthcare environment.
10-key calculator, keyboarding, and use of other office machines such as copier, fax, etc. Knowledge of third-party payers - Medicare, Medicaid, and Commercial insurance. Outstanding people skills, including telephone technique, personal appearance, organization skills, communicable skills (oral and written), independent and self-motivate, flexible, analytic and arithmetic skills, negotiation skills, problem solving skills and computer skills including some understanding of word processing and spreadsheet applications.
